Advanced Cell Balancing : Prolongs battery life by ensuring consistent state-of-charge across all cells.
Temperature Management : Optimizes battery performance and safety by maintaining optimal operating temperatures.
State-of-Charge (SOC) Estimation : Accurately determines the remaining battery capacity for efficient energy management.
State-of-Health (SOH) Estimation : Monitors battery degradation to predict remaining useful life.
Cell Voltage Monitoring : Continuously tracks individual cell voltages to prevent overcharging and over-discharging.
Current Monitoring : Precisely measures battery current to optimize charging and discharging rates.
Communication Protocols : Supports various communication protocols for seamless integration with vehicle or energy management systems.
Safety Features : Incorporates advanced safety mechanisms to protect against overcurrent, short circuit, and thermal runaway.
Diagnostic Capabilities : Provides detailed battery health information for predictive maintenance and troubleshooting.
